To delete this date: * Click the **Delete** icon next to the activity. * Select **Delete** to confirm. ![Delete Expected Payment Date](/books/help/images/bills/expected-payment-date3.png) * * * ## Create Vendor Credits You can create vendor credits for any bill. When you do so, all the items in the bill will be included in the vendor credit. To create a vendor credit: * Go to the _Purchases_ module in the left sidebar and select **Bills**. * Select the bill for which you wish to create vendor credits. * Click **More** > **Create Vendor Credits**. ![Create Vendor Credits](/books/help/images/bills/create-vendor-credit1.png) * Click **Proceed**. ![Create Vendor Credits](/books/help/images/bills/create-vendor-credit2.png) * Fill in the required details of the vendor credit and save it. ![New Vendor Credit](/books/help/images/bills/create-vendor-credit3.png) **Insight:** Once you create a vendor credit for the bill, it will automatically be applied to the bill, and the bill’s status will change to **Paid**. If the vendor credit amount exceeds the bill amount, then the entire payment for the bill will be recorded and the excess amount will be stored as the balance amount for the vendor credit. * * * ## Customize Template You can customize the format of your bill’s PDF. Here’s how: * Go to **Purchases** on the left sidebar and select _Bills_. * Select the bill for which you wish to customize the template. * Hover over the bill and click the Customize button in the top right corner. * From here, you can perform various actions for the bill’s template. ![Customize Template](/books/help/images/bills/customize-template.png) Learn more about [Templates](/om/books/help/settings/templates.html) and [Bill Templates](/om/books/help/settings/templates.html#bill). * * * ## Landed Costs The Landed Cost of a product is the cost incurred while bringing a product that you have purchased from your vendor into your warehouse. This cost is exclusive of the cost of goods. Few examples of landed costs include freight, shipping charges, customs and other charges that the seller may incur till they procures the goods. Tracking the landed costs help you calculate the actual cost in receiving the product(s). This, in turn, will help you to decide the selling price for your stock without compromising your profits. ### Enable Landed Costs To enable landed costs in Zoho Books: * Go to **Settings** on the top right corner of the page. * Select **Items** under _Items_. * Check the **Track landed cost on items** option. * Click **Save**. ![Enable Landed Costs](/books/help/images/bills/enable-lc.png) **Note:** You will be able to enable landed costs only if you have enabled inventory tracking for your organization. If you haven’t enabled it yet, mark the box **I would like to enable Inventory** in the same page. ### Allocate Landed Costs Once you have [enabled](/om/books/help/bills/functions.html#enable-landed-costs) landed costs for your organization, you will be able to add and allocate them to the items in your bills. **Step 1: Adding Landed Costs to Bills** You can allocate landed costs directly to the whole bill itself. * Go to the _Purchases_ module in the left sidebar and select **Bills**. * Create a new bill and enter the items. * Click **\+ Landed Cost** below the Item Details and enter the additional cost incurred as an item (for e.g. Freight). You can create a new item as a Service or choose one that you might have created already. ![Landed Costs in Bills](/books/help/images/bills/allocate-lc-bills.png) * Click **Save as Draft** or click **Save as Open and Apply Landed Costs** to start allocating the costs to items. **Note:** Landed Costs can be allocated only to items for which inventory is tracked. **Step 2: Allocate Landed Costs to Items in the Bill** You can allocate landed costs to different items in a bill. There are three ways of doing this: 1. Allocate landed costs while creating a bill * Create a new bill, add Landed Costs to the bill, and click **Save as Open and Apply Landed Costs**. * When you are saving the bill, a popup will appear, from where you’ll be able to allocate the landed costs to the bill proportionately based on the **Value** or **Quantity** of the items. * Edit the **Charge** fields if you would like to make changes to the costs calculated. * Click **Save & Next** if there are two or more landed costs to be allocated. * Click **Skip** if you wish to allocate the landed cost later. ![Landed Costs in Bills](/books/help/images/bills/allocate-lc-items.png) * Click **Save**. > **Note:** > You can also choose not to allocate any landed costs to that particular bill and allocate them to other bills. 2. Allocate landed costs to an existing bill If you have already added landed cost(s) to a bill but not yet allocated them to its items, you can choose to allocate it. * Select a bill for which you have added landed cost(s) but not yet allocated them to its items. * Click the **Allocate Landed Costs** button on your bill details page to allocate it to a bill. ![Allocate Landed Costs](/books/help/images/bills/allocate-lc-bills1.png) * Allocate the charges proportionately and click **Save**. ![Allocate Landed Costs](/books/help/images/bills/allocate-lc-bills2.png) * You can **Edit** the allocated cost or delete it by clicking the **Delete** icon. ![Allocate Landed Costs](/books/help/images/bills/allocate-lc-bills3.png) **Pro Tip:** You can also edit bills created earlier to add landed costs to them and allocate it. ### Allocating Landed Costs from One Bill to Another There may be cases where your vendor does not offer any shipping for the product and you get it shipped by another shipping agency. In such a case, you can create a separate bill with just the landed costs and apply them to your vendor’s bill. You can also apply any unused landed costs from other bills.
